is it stude or jackson or both?

i thought jackson looked like his usual puss self...i didn't catch much of the 2nd half...I don't think Jackson's a puss as much I think he doesn't always do what exactly what he's supposed to. Which in this defense is a big deal. But I do think he does an adequate job of occupying his guy(s).

I think too many people (and I don't mean you when I'm saying this, just making a general comment...) are expecting the wrong thing from our d-line. This is not the Cowboys defense, these guys are not busting upfield to make plays in the backfield. That's just not their role. And I think failing to grasp that is what leads to so many people (starting with the media) complaining about Jackson and (I'm expecting...) Gregg and even Dorsey. Not taking down ball carriers in the backfield and not sacking quarterbacks does not mean they're playing poorly. Because, basically, the only time they get to go after guys is when a blocking assignment is completely whiffed. The rest of the time it's boring old trench work. Now if they get blown off the ball, that's another story. But most of the time their job is about holding people up so the linebackers are free to do their thing.

And unfortunately, Studebaker doesn't appear to be able to do that a lot of the time. He's not very agile or quick laterally, he doesn't have any speed in pursuit and he doesn't have the experience and knowledge that in the past let Vrabel compensate (to a degree) for those same limitations. I think we're going to see a lot of people targetting the left side of the defense this year, and while some of that may well be Jackson (he's not Dorsey...), I think the real weak link is Stude. Too many running plays this preseason have been stalled at the line, and then taken outside where he doesn't have the speed to cut them off before they get the corner.
